1 1th, Brace's Mortification, under the patronage of the
Provost, Dean of Guild, the three first Ministers, and the
Rector of the Grammar School, from which one boy re-
ceives yearly .£8 6s. 8d. for maintenance and education.
12th, Constable's Mortification, under the patronage
of the Provost, Dean of Guild, and Minister of the Parish,
from which fourteen boys receive £S yearly for education,
for four years.
Besides these, the Kirk Session pay the School Fees
of Children of poor parents, for two years : the number
of these in general is from 50 to 60; making a total of
287 — independent of the Orphan Institution, where
nearly twenty children are boarded and educated. ..
